CEU Course Description
Chronic kidney disease (CKD) is a vastly complex condition that has many causes, risk factors, and implications for the patient’s health. With 35.5 million adults in the United States living with CKD, it is important that nurses are knowledgeable about this disease and can provide evidence-based care to improve outcomes. To understand the effects of CKD, nurses must first review the anatomy and physiology of the normal kidney. They should understand the early signs and symptoms of CKD, how the disease is staged, and which factors increase the risk of CKD and its progression. Nurses must also understand the cardiovascular implications of CKD. Nurses who are knowledgeable about interpreting renal function lab results and the interventions used to manage CKD and prevent progression can positively affect patient outcomes. Through effective nursing interventions and patient education strategies, nurses can help slow the progression of CKD and optimize patient outcomes.
